Ultimate Guide to UPVC Door Repair
UPVC Door Locks Installation (Unplasticized Polyvinyl Chloride) doors are a popular choice for property owners due to their toughness, energy effectiveness, and low maintenance requirements. However, like any product, they can encounter problems over time. In this comprehensive guide, we will cover the typical issues faced by UPVC doors, how to repair them, and supply a comprehensive FAQ section about UPVC door maintenance.
Typical UPVC Door Issues
Before diving into repair techniques, it's vital to determine the most regular issues that homeowners confront with their UPVC doors. The following table summarizes these concerns, their symptoms, and possible options.
| Problem | Signs | Possible Solutions |
|---|---|---|
| Door Misalignment | Door sticking, drafts, or inability to close correctly | Re-align the door by adjusting hinges |
| Harmed Lock | Trouble locking/unlocking, rattling noises | Replace the lock or lubrication |
| Weather Stripping Wear | Drafts, increased energy expenses, condensation inside | Replace weather stripping |
| Split Door Panel | Noticeable fractures, water leakage | Usage UPVC adhesive for minor fractures; change for significant damage |
| Handle Issues | Loose or damaged handle, trouble in operation | Tightening up screws or changing the handle |
| Faded Surface | Discoloration, loss of visual appeals | Use UPVC cleaner or replace door |
| Broken Hinges | Door sagging, misalignment | Replace or tighten hinges. |
Detailed Repair Methods
1. Straightening the Door
Signs:
- The door doesn't close properly.
- There are noticeable spaces around the edges.
Actions to Realign:
- Identify Misalignment: Close the door to see where it sticks or fails to fulfill the frame.
- Change Hinges: Use a screwdriver to tighten or loosen hinge screws on the door. Moving the top hinge somewhat up can assist straighten the door. On the other hand, the bottom hinge may need to be changed downwards.
- Examine the Alignment: Close the door again to examine for proper alignment.
2. Lock Repair/Replacement
Signs:

- The lock feels stiff or does not engage correctly.
Actions for Repair:
- Lubricate the Lock: Use graphite or silicone lubricant to loosen any internal systems.
- Inspect for Damage: If lubrication does not fix the problem, analyze the lock for damage.
- Replace if Necessary: Remove the lock by loosening it and replace it with a brand-new lock that matches your door's requirements.
3. Weather Stripping Replacement
Signs:
- Drafts around the door frame, higher energy costs.
Steps to Replace:
- Remove Old Stripping: Peel away worn weather condition removing from the door frame.
- Tidy the Surface: Ensure the area is tidy and dry.
- Use New Stripping: Cut a brand-new weather stripping to size and press it strongly into location.
4. Repairing Cracked Door Panels
Signs:
- Cracks or gaps visible on the door surface.
Steps to Repair:
- Clean the Area: Make sure the split area is clean.
- Using UPVC Adhesive: Apply a UPVC adhesive into the crack and firmly press the material together. Rub out any excess adhesive.
- Change if Severe: If the crack is too extensive, think about replacing the whole panel personally or through a service professional.
5. Handle Replacement
Symptoms:
- Loose or unusable handle.
Actions to Replace:
- Remove the Handle: Unscrew the current handle and take it out.
- Inspect the Mechanism: Ensure the locking system works before installing the new handle.
- Install New Handle: Place the new handle in and protect it with screws.
6. Cleaning up the Surface
Symptoms:
- Fading or staining on the surface of the door.
Actions to Clean:
- Use a UPVC Cleaner: Apply a non-abrasive cleaner ideal for UPVC surface areas.
- Scrub Gently: Use a soft fabric or sponge to avoid scratching the surface area.
- Rinse Thoroughly: Ensure that no cleaner residue remains on the door.
7. Hinge Replacement/Tightening
Symptoms:
- Door sagging or not opening efficiently.
Steps to Address:
- Check Screws: Tighten any loose screws on the hinges.
- Replace Hinges: If the hinges are harmed, eliminate the old hinges and install new ones. Make certain the new ones are suitable with your door.
Maintenance Tips for Your UPVC Door
To extend the life of your UPVC doors and reduce the need for repairs, follow these maintenance tips:
- Regular Cleaning: Clean your door periodically with a suggested UPVC cleaner.
- Inspect Seals: Components like weather condition stripping should be examined frequently and changed if they reveal indications of wear.
- Lube Moving Parts: Apply silicone spray or lube to locks, hinges, and joints to ensure smooth operation.
- Changes: Keep an eye out for any misalignment and make changes as needed.
- Professional Inspections: Schedule inspections with a professional to examine the total health of your door.
Frequently Asked Question About UPVC Door Repair
Q1: How typically should I maintain my UPVC door?
It's suggested to carry out maintenance every 6 months or at least when a year, depending on ecological conditions.
Q2: Can I repair my UPVC door myself?
Yes, numerous typical problems can be resolved through DIY approaches. Nevertheless, for severe issues, it's best to consult a professional.

Q3: How long should UPVC doors last?
With correct care and maintenance, UPVC doors can last anywhere from 20 to 30 years.
Q4: What do I do if my door will not lock?
Check the positioning and lubricate the lock mechanisms first. If that doesn't solve the problem, think about a replacement.
